John Custis II    1628-1695

Spouse Elizabeth Robinson 1633 - 1654

Burial: Custis Tombs

 

John, born in the Netherlands, moved to the Eastern Shore in 1649/1650.

He grew wealthy through trade, land speculation, and tobacco planting.

He accumulated over 11,000 acres.

John assembled cargoes of tobacco for shipment to the Dutch Colony.

He also acted as the Virginia agent for merchants from New Netherland

and Rotterdam, as well as New England.

 

John Custis, Esq   1654-1714

Son of John Custis II & Elizabeth Robinson Custis

Burial: Custis Tombs

 

John Custis IV   1678-1749

Son of John Custis & Margaret Michael Custis

Burial: Custis Tombs

He was buried in a standing position by his request.

 

Daniel Parke Custis   1711 - 1757

Son of John Custis & Frances Park Custis

Burial: Bruton Parish Episcopal Church Cemetery

Williamsburg, VA

 

Daniel married Martha Dandridge on May 10, 1750.

Martha, after Daniel’s death in 1757, married George Washington.
